How to Use a Diabetes Tracking Chart
Using a diabetes tracking chart is easy and can be a valuable tool in managing your diabetes effectively. To get started, download and print a printable diabetes tracking chart that suits your needs. You can find a variety of free templates online that include sections for recording blood sugar levels, medications, meals, and exercise.
Once you have your tracking chart, make it a habit to fill it out daily. Record your blood sugar levels before and after meals, note any changes in medication dosages, and track your physical activity. Over time, you will start to see patterns and trends in your data that can help you and your healthcare provider make adjustments to your diabetes management plan.
